Transaction 89b9fda09e297f2430304ae96913552837aee4bb60bbd364afe4aaf707630e33
1 Input
1 Output
-
89b9fda09e297f2430304ae96913552837aee4bb60bbd364afe4aaf707630e33:0
- value
- 26038064
- script pubkey
- OP_0 OP_PUSHBYTES_20 22d60095afc4a6ffda35a813a02d33b9d1fe5941
- address
- bc1qyttqp9d0cjn0lk344qf6qtfnh8gluk2p67ujn4